JaneGoodallisknowntodayasagreatresearcherwhohasspentmuchofherlifestudyingchimpanzees(黑猩猩).Butbeforehersuccessshewasjustagirlwhowishedshecouldbe“asclosetoanimalsasIcould.”Itwasn’tlongbeforeherdreamcametrue.Shebeganherresearchinthe1960sinTanzania.HerteacherwasresearcherLouisLeakey.Heemployedheralthoughshelackedacademicexperience.Shewas26andtoopoortoattendauniversity.
Thedocumentary“Jane”bringsGoodall’sstorytovividlife.Thefilmmainlycameaboutbecauseofthe2014discoveryofmorethan140hoursofpreviouslyunseenfootage(片段)fromthe1960s.Itwasfilmedmostlybyherthen-husbandHugovanLawick.Weseethebeginningofherexplorations.It’sasifwehavesteppedintoatimemachine.WeareupclosenotonlytoGoodallbuttothechimpanzees,astheyslowlylearntoacceptherpresenceinthewild.Butatfirst,theysawherasanoutsider.Shewasa“strangewhiteape(猿)”tothem,Goodallsays.Becauseofthat,shefeltthat“Iwasn’treallylearninganythingmuch.”
Goodall’sbigbreakthroughcamewhensheobserved,DavidGreybeard,aseniormalechimpanzee,makingatwig(细枝)intoatoolforrootingouttermites(smallwhiteinsects).Untilthen,itwasthoughtthatonlyhumansmadetools.Herfindingsweremadefunofatfirstbythealmostentirelymalescientificcommunity.Gradually,though,theywereaccepted.
However,afterherbelovedchimpanzeecommunitygotintoawarwithotherchimpanzees,shemakesitclearthatshenolongerhadanybeliefthattheanimalworldwasperfectorpeaceful.Shesaidthat“Ihadnoideaofthecrueltythattheycouldshow.”This,too,iswhatlinksuswiththeapes,andit’sclearthatthisissomethingshefeelssadtoadmit.
GoodallremainsachampionofAfricanapesthroughtheJaneGoodallInstitute,whichprotectsthemfrombeinghunted.Whocouldhavepredictedthatthe26-year-oldwomanthatwefirstseein“Jane”wouldendupleadingtheword’sresearchofchimpanzees?
Well,asthisfilmshows,JaneGoodallcouldhavepredictedit.
